Maintenance is Critical for ROI: Flat roof solar systems require semi-annual professional cleaning and monthly visual inspections due to increased debris accumulation, but the easier access reduces maintenance costs by 20-30% compared to sloped roof systems. The installation of PV panels on rooftops can add significant weight to the structure. Over time, this extra load can lead to stress on the roof, potentially causing leaks, sagging, or even collapse in extreme cases. When installing photovoltaic panels on one- and two-family homes, it's important to understand the requirements for access pathways and the requirements for setback from the ridge, which only apply to roofs with a slope greater than a 2-in-12 pitch.
